2010–11 UEFA Women's Champions League - tenth edition of the European women's club football championship organized by UEFA. Article “Uefa Women's Champions League 2010/2011” in Swedish Wikipedia has 31 points for quality (as of July 1, 2025). The article contains 6 references and 20 sections.
